Jake Paul vs Gervonta Davis fight in jeopardy after new update from athletic commission

The controversially planned fight between Jake Paul and Gervonta Davis is at risk of being called off following a recent update.

Almost a month ago, it was shockingly announced that controversial boxer Jake Paul‘s next fight would take place against lightweight world champion, Gervonta Davis.

The announcement came just months after he scored a unanimous decision win over former world champion Julio Cesar Chavez Jr, who was widely regarded as Paul’s toughest opponent yet.

Not long after his fight against ‘Tank’ Davis at the State Farm Arena in Georgia was announced, ‘The Problem Child’ began receiving criticism for once again fighting someone in a lower weight class than him.

Jake Paul vs Gervonta Davis in jeopardy

Of course, it isn’t the first time the 28-year-old has received criticism for his choice of opponent as his fight last November against Mike Tyson was widely frowned upon in the combat sports world.

And with that, his scheduled upcoming fight against Davis on November 14 has been branded as ‘disgusting’ because of the huge weight discrepancy between the two.

Despite his attempt to drown out the negativity surrounding the fight by agreeing to the ‘strictest drug testing possible’, after a new update from the Georgia Athletic and Entertainment Commission, the fight is now in jeopardy.

On Tuesday, Rick Thompson, the chairman of the Georgia State Athletic and Entertainment Commission revealed that Most Valuable Promotions, the promoter of the event, had withdrawn their request for event permits and rule waivers to hold the event in Georgia.

“I believe it’s in the public’s interest to know that because they’ve been promoting something they should not have been,” Thompson told USA Today Sports.

Big changes expected for Jake Paul’s next fight

At this point, it is unclear what the status of the fight between Paul and Davis is, as there was a press conference scheduled to take place from the State Farm Arena this coming Thursday.

With the co-founder of Most Valuable Promotions, Nakisa Bidarian having teased a big announcement this Wednesday, the status of the fight will likely be confirmed and a new location for the super fight will likely be announced.
